Belirli bir klasörde bir dosyanın var olup olmadığını nasıl kontrol edebilirim?
Eğer birden fazla dosya içeren bir klasörünüz varsa ve belirli bir dosyanın var olup olmadığını belirlemeniz gerekiyorsa, Excel bu görevi otomatikleştirmenize yardımcı olabilir. Bu makale, belirli bir klasörde bir dosyanın var olup olmadığını kontrol etmek için basit bir VBA yöntemi sunar.
VBA kodu ile belirli bir klasörde bir dosyanın var olup olmadığını kontrol edin
VBA kodu ile belirli bir klasörde bir dosyanın var olup olmadığını kontrol edin
Excel çalışma sayfasında belirli bir klasörde bir dosyanın var olup olmadığını kontrol etmek için aşağıdaki VBA kodunu uygulayabilirsiniz, lütfen şu adımları izleyin:
1. Microsoft Visual Basic for Applications penceresini açmak için ALT + F11 tuşlarına basın.
2. Ekle Insert > Module'e tıklayın ve aşağıdaki kodu Modül Penceresine yapıştırın.
VBA kodu: Belirli bir klasörde bir dosyanın var olup olmadığını kontrol edin:
Sub Test_File_Exist_With_Dir()
'Updateby Extendoffice
Application.ScreenUpdating = False
Dim FilePath As String
FilePath = ""
On Error Resume Next
FilePath = Dir("C:\Users\DT168\Desktop\Test folder\Book2.xlsx")
On Error GoTo 0
If FilePath = "" Then
MsgBox "File doesn't exist", vbInformation, "Kutools for Excel"
Else
MsgBox "File exists", vbInformation, "Kutools for Excel"
End If
Application.ScreenUpdating = False
End Sub
Not: Yukarıdaki kodda, dosya yolunu ve adını C:\Users\DT168\Desktop\Test folder\Book2.xlsx" ihtiyacınıza göre değiştirmelisiniz.
3. Kodu yapıştırdıktan sonra, lütfen bu kodu çalıştırmak için F5 tuşuna basın:
(1.) Eğer dosya mevcutsa, aşağıdaki ekran görüntüsünü alacaksınız:
(2.) Eğer dosya mevcut değilse, aşağıdaki uyarıyı alacaksınız:
En İyi Ofis Verimlilik Araçları
Kutools for Excel ile Excel becerilerinizi geliştirin ve daha önce hiç olmadığı kadar verimli olun. Kutools for Excel, üretkenliğinizi artırmak ve zamanınızı kaydetmek için300'den fazla gelişmiş özellik sunar. En çok ihtiyacınız olan özelliği almak için buraya tıklayın...
Office Tab, Office'e sekmeli arayüz getirir ve işinizi çok daha kolaylaştırır
- Word, Excel, PowerPoint'te sekmeli düzenleme ve okuma özelliğini etkinleştirin.
- Aynı pencerenin yeni sekmelerinde birden fazla belge açın ve oluşturun, yeni pencerelerde değil.
- Verimliliğinizi %50 artırır ve her gün yüzlerce fare tıklamasını azaltır!